Saltar al contenido principal
La clase SignupPassword implementa la funcionalidad de la pantalla signup-password. Esta pantalla recopila la contraseña del usuario.
Contraseña de registro con identificadores flexibles

Constructores

Cree una instancia del administrador de la pantalla SignupPassword:
Example
import SignupPassword from '@auth0/auth0-acul-js/signup-password';
const signupPasswordManager = new SignupPassword();
signupPasswordManager.signup({
  email: 'test@example.com',
  password: 'P@$wOrd123!',
});

Propiedades

Proporciona configuraciones de marca, como el tema y otros ajustes de marca.
Proporciona configuraciones relacionadas con el cliente, como id, name y logoUrl, para la pantalla signup-password.
Proporciona información sobre la Organización del usuario, como id y name.
Contiene datos sobre la pantalla actual del flujo de autenticación.
Contiene detalles específicos de la pantalla signup-password, incluida su configuración y contexto.
Contiene datos relacionados con el inquilino, como id y los metadatos asociados.
Proporciona datos específicos de la transacción, como identificadores activos y estados del flujo.
Gestiona datos no confiables que se pasan al SDK, como la información introducida por el usuario durante el inicio de sesión.
Contiene detalles del usuario activo, incluidos username, email y roles.

Métodos

changeLanguage
Promise<void>
Este método cambia el idioma de visualización de la página de Universal Login.
Example
import SignupPassword from '@auth0/auth0-acul-js/signup-password';
const signupPasswordManager = new SignupPassword();
signupPasswordManager.changeLanguage({
  language: 'fr',
});
Parámetros del método
federatedSignup
Promise<void>
Este método permite registrarse con distintos identificadores sociales. Por ejemplo: Google, Facebook, etc.
Example
import SignupPassword from '@auth0/auth0-acul-js/signup-password';
const signupPasswordManager = new SignupPassword();
signupPasswordManager.federatedSignup({
  connection: 'google-oauth2',
});
Parámetros del método
getErrors
Este método recupera del contexto el array de errores de la transacción, o un array vacío si no hay ninguno.
signup
Promise<void>
Este método procesa el envío del formulario de registro con contraseña.
Example
import SignupPassword from '@auth0/auth0-acul-js/signup-password';
const signupPasswordManager = new SignupPassword();
signupPasswordManager.signup({
  email: 'test@example.com',
  password: 'P@$wOrd123!',
});
Parámetros del método
switchConnection
Promise<void>
Este método cambia la conexión de autenticación durante el flujo signup-password.
Example
import SignupPassword from '@auth0/auth0-acul-js/signup-password';
const signupPasswordManager = new SignupPassword();
signupPasswordManager.switchConnection({
  connection: 'Username-Password-Authentication',
});
Parámetros del método
Este método valida una contraseña según la política de contraseñas de la transacción actual. Devuelve un objeto que indica si la contraseña es válida y el motivo.
Ejemplo
import SignupPassword from '@auth0/auth0-acul-js/signup-password';
const signupPasswordManager = new SignupPassword();
const result = signupPasswordManager.validatePassword('MyP@ssw0rd!');
Parámetros del método